Thyristor Power Converters: Function, Applications, Advantages & Disadvantages
Thyristors are semiconductor devices that tend to stay ‘ON’ once turned ON, and tend to stay ‘OFF’ once turned OFF. A momentary event is able to flip these devices into either ON or OFF states, where they will remain that way on their own, even after the cause of the state change is taken away.…

How cycloconverter is used as a direct frequency converter
The cycloconverter provides direct ac to ac transformation with control over both the output voltage magnitude and output frequency. It employs phase-angle-controlled bridges to synthesize voltages.
